My wife and I fly into SJU airport from Miami at 6:40 pm on Jan 28 and leave on Jetblue flight the next afternoon at 3pm for SXM. Can anyone recommend a good hotel/motel that is not directly under the airport traffic in San Juan and fairly inexpensive. We will need to do the same on the way back to Miami. We'll only be there for the eevening and part of the afternoon so we don't want to rent a car. We'll use the airport shuttle back and forth.

If you're still looking I think the Intercontinental at $190 plus fees is a good bet at this point for a nice hotel close to the airport. There are some places that are a bit cheaper, but I agree with Nutmeg that you need to proceed with caution when it comes to a cheap hotel in San Juan. With the Intercontinental you'll have the beach and a nice pool and facilities, plus the El San Juan right next door if you want to get a little crazy. Stay up late, wake up early and sleep it off at the airport and on the flight.
